METHOD FOR SINGLE CELL ISOLATION AND RNA EXTRACTION FROM WOODY TISSUES

The present patent application discloses a method for single cell isolation and RNA extraction in woody plants' tissues, while preserving the viability of the nucleic acids for further analysis. The method comprises, collecting a woody plant tissue sample, snap-freezing and embedding the sample in Optimal Cutting Temperature (OCT) freezing medium, sectioning of the frozen samples into sections of 10 to 20 µm of thickness, fixation and dehydration of plant sections, isolation of single cells by laser microdissection, RNA extraction from isolated single-cells, wherein the RNA extraction comprises the use of a lysis buffer comprising stabilizers.;Thus, it is disclosed here for the first time a method for single cell isolation and RNA extraction of isolated woody tissues comprising xylem and suberized cells while still maintaining RNA integrity for RNA sequence analysis.
